Democrats Who Backed Noem’s DHS Confirmation Now Criticize Her Leadership

Senators say her hardline immigration approach has diverged from her campaign promises.

Overview

  • Seven Senate Democrats joined Republicans to confirm Kristi Noem as DHS secretary in a 59-34 vote on January 25, 2025.
  • Noem’s tenure has been marked by aggressive deportation actions targeting green card holders and international students.
  • Sens. Tim Kaine and Andy Kim now say they regret endorsing her nomination and would oppose her confirmation if given another vote.
  • Sens. Gary Peters and Elissa Slotkin have voiced disagreement with her policy choices but emphasize the need for a working relationship on homeland security oversight.
  • Sen. Adam Schiff labeled her leadership among the worst in DHS history, criticizing draconian policies and inconsistent public conduct.
